LNG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2018 in Review

496 of the 4,368 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Cheniere Energy (LNG) for Q2 2018, worth a combined $15.5B — up 28% from $12.2B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 97 funds opened new LNG positions and 35 closed out — a net gain of 62 holders — while 187 added to existing stakes and 133 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Zimmer Partners, opening a new position worth an estimated $354M. The largest seller was Icahn Carl, cutting an estimated $554M.
